The Recovery Based Engagement Support Team (RBEST) project provides community (field-based) services throughout San Bernardino County for those mentally ill individuals who are noncompliant and/or resistant to necessary psychiatric care in an effort to activate the individual into the mental health system to receive appropriate services. PMRT consists of LACDMH clinicians designated to perform evaluations for involuntary detention of individuals determined to be at risk of harming themselves or others, or who are unable to provide food, clothing, or shelter for themselves. The implementation of a PERT program in Riverside County would not only decrease police presence during emergency responses to a person experiencing behavioral health issues, but it would also ensure that a licensed mental health clinician is always in attendance with a law enforcement officer to assess the person in distress.
